Summary
Drew Allar, a rookie quarterback for the Pittsburgh Steelers, had an impressive preseason debut, leading the team to three touchdown drives and completing 10-of-13 passes for 158 yards. This performance has sparked criticism of Virginia Tech head coach James Franklin, who coached Allar at Penn State, with some fans accusing Franklin of failing to develop Allar’s skills properly. Allar’s mechanics and confidence have improved significantly since joining the Steelers, leading some to question Franklin’s coaching abilities.
